While live feeds are vital for hurricane tracking, individuals have a crucial role to play in mitigating the effects of such storms.
Preparation
Individuals must prepare well before a hurricane strikes by stocking up on essential supplies such as food, water, and medication. They should also secure their homes and evacuate if necessary.
Stay Informed
Staying informed through live feeds and other official sources is essential for individual safety during a hurricane. People should avoid rumors and misinformation on social media or through unverified sources.
